Use Radius Targeting

Radius targeting will be your ace move, especially if your goal is to deeply connect with their local audience. By specifying a particular geographic area around your location, you can deliver ads directly to potential customers nearby. Imagine running a promotion that’s only valid in your city or neighborhood. Radius targeting allows you to set parameters based on miles, ensuring that only those within reach see your offers. This not only boosts relevance but also increases the chances of conversions. Moreover, this strategy helps reduce wasted ad spend by focusing resources where they matter most.

Leverage Location Extensions

Location extensions, on the other hand, allow you to display your business address, phone number, and even directions directly in your ads. When potential customers are willing to find services near them, these extensions make it easy for them to find you. Including this information increases the likelihood of engagement. It also enhances trust by showing you’re a legitimate business in their area. Utilizing location extensions can significantly improve click-through rates. People want convenience; they appreciate seeing where you are located right at their fingertips. Plus, integrating Google Maps into your ads provides an intuitive way for users to navigate directly to your store or service location.

Tailor Ads to Local Events

Did you know that local events offer a golden opportunity to connect with your audience? When you tailor ads around these happenings, you create relevant content that resonates. Think about seasonal festivities, sports events, or community fairs. These occasions draw crowds and spark local interest. Customizing your ads to align with these moments can significantly boost engagement. For instance, if there’s a street fair in your area, highlight how your products fit into the event’s vibe. Showcase special deals or promotions that are available only during the occasion. This not only attracts attention but also drives foot traffic.

Dayparting Based on Location

Dayparting allows advertisers to optimize their ad spend by targeting users at specific times of day. This strategy varies based on location, as different regions have unique peak activity hours. For example, a coffee shop in a bustling downtown area may see high foot traffic during morning commute hours. In contrast, an evening restaurant might focus its ads around dinner time when locals are looking for dining options. By analyzing data from your target audience’s behavior patterns, you can adjust your campaigns accordingly. Use insights related to local habits and trends to determine the best times to show your ads.
